The Power Quality Equipment market in Benin is expanding, particularly in the industrial, commercial, and residential sectors, where maintaining high power quality is essential for the reliable operation of electrical systems. Power quality equipment is valued for its ability to mitigate issues such as voltage fluctuations, harmonics, and power outages. The market is driven by the increasing demand for reliable power supply and the need to protect sensitive electronic equipment. Challenges include managing the cost of equipment, competition from alternative power quality solutions, and ensuring the adaptability of equipment to different power environments.

The Power Quality Equipment market in Benin encounters challenges such as high costs associated with the acquisition and maintenance of equipment. Limited local manufacturing and distribution capabilities can restrict market access and availability. The market is further complicated by the need for technical expertise and regulatory compliance, which can be demanding in the region. Supply chain inefficiencies and competition from alternative solutions also impact market growth. Additionally, fluctuations in global demand and pricing for power quality equipment add to the market`s complexity. Addressing these challenges is crucial for developing a robust and reliable power quality equipment market in Benin.
The Power Quality Equipment market in Benin is shaped by government policies related to energy management, industrial applications, and infrastructure reliability. Policies promoting the use of power quality equipment to prevent disruptions and ensure stable power supply in industrial and commercial facilities are crucial for market growth. Regulations concerning equipment standards, performance, and safety are significant factors influencing the market. Government initiatives to support industrial modernization and invest in reliable energy infrastructure further impact the market.
